Research Paper Published

A research paper by senior ICHK students has been published.

We are very pleased to share the paper, which appears in the latest issue of ‘School Science Review’.

A group of Year 13 students spent the summer working on the paper, as part of a global education initiative around the climate emergency.

The team worked with Head of Science Michelle Rines, PHD researcher Smriti Safaya and teachers and university students in Hong Kong on the project.

Among the issues they researched were opportunities for education for climate action in curricular and extra curricular school science; the responsibilities of teachers in relation to climate action and the models that exist for collective action through school science.

The paper is a shining example of student achievement and the team is to be commended on all the effort and hard work that went into it.

Entitled "Listening to youth: how to close the knowledge-action gap in climate change education", it can be read here.
